特异性

Reacts with choline acetyltransferase (ChAT)-positive cells from humans, rats and pigs (Ostermann-Fatif et al., 1992a,b).

免疫原

Highly purified ChAT obtained from porcine brain (Ostermann-Fatif et al., 1990).

This Anti-Choline Acetyltransferase Antibody, clone 1.B3.9B3 is validated for use in ELISA, IH, IH(P), WB for the detection of Choline Acetyltransferase.
Western blot

ELISA

Immunohistochemistry: 10-20 μg/mL in paraffin embedded sections {See Ratcliffe et al. 1998}

Optimal working dilutions and protocols must be determined by end user.

外形

Protein A purified
Format: Purified
Purified immunoglobulin. Lyophilized from 0.02 M Phosphate buffer, 0.25 M NaCl with 0.1% sodium azide. Reconstitute to 100 μg/mL with sterile distilled water.

储存及稳定性

Maintain lyophilized antibody at 2–8°C in undiluted aliquots for up to 6 months. Maintain reconstituted antibody at -20°C in undiluted aliquots for up to 6 months.
